Choosing a West Plains Moving Company

Different types of movers are suited for different sorts of moves. The first step in choosing a moving company is deciding whether a local or national mover is best suited to your needs. You also will have to choose between a full-service or self-service moving company. Both types of companies provide trucks and drivers. However, full-service companies also provide packing and loading services, while self-service companies do not. The company that you ultimately pick will depend on your budget and how much you hate packing boxes.

Once you know what you need, learn which movers meet Missouri's licensing requirements for movers. Other ways to research a mover's credibility include reading online reviews and checking its reputation via the BBB. Every company on our list of West Plains' best movers is well-reviewed and selected by our experts.

After you have narrowed your list down to just a few companies, you can start asking for estimates. It is best to speak to at least one or two of the companies on our list above. When talking to a company you are thinking of hiring, make sure that you explain all of the services you think you'll require. Also, check that the estimate you receive is a "binding estimate," because otherwise it may be subject to change.

How Much Do Movers in West Plains Cost?

Something that many people worry about when moving is the price tag. In West Plains, the typical hourly cost for movers is:

  • Average: $43 per hour
  • Range: $34 to $53 per hour
Also consider the size of your home when figuring moving costs. In West Plains, the amount you'll spend on movers will vary based on the size of your home:
  • One bedroom: About $435
  • Two bedrooms: About $652
  • Three bedrooms: About $978

When picking a date to move, you'll want to consider both cost and convenience. Moving during the summer months tends to be more expensive, as most people move during this season. You also might encounter more traffic during these months. There are about 1,571 college students attending school within 15 miles of West Plains, so you may wish to avoid moving in May and August, when they will be moving.

Don't forget to think about the weather, too. West Plains' temperatures tend to be warm. Your move will likely be inconvenient and possibly dangerous if you move on a day where the weather is too hot.

A few signs that you shouldn't use a specific mover include:

  • The company avoids questions about its credentials and insurance coverage.
  • The company offers discounts, quotes, or promotions that sound too good to be true.
  • The company can't provide you with references.
  • The company demands that you pay upfront.
  • The company isn't in good standing with the Better Business Bureau or Federal Motor Carrier Safety Agency.

You should choose a local mover if you want a more personal experience. Local movers know the West Plains area better and can offer more tailored services. However, national movers usually have more resources, better insurance, and a wider variety of services.
